Mr. Andersen explains elementary reactions, focusing on molecular collisions and energy requirements. He demonstrates unimolecular, bimolecular, and termolecular reactions, discussing their rate laws and predictability. The video emphasizes the complexity of reaction mechanisms and the need to measure reaction rates.
